    BOHEMIA, NY and PITTSBURGH, PA / ACCESSWIRE / August 8, 2022 / Scientific Industries, Inc. (OTCQB:SCND), a life science tool provider, and a developer of digitally simplified products, announced today its subsidiary Scientific Bioprocessing (SBI) announces the launch of DOTS, a visionary sensor platform for bioprocessing at the 2022 Annual Meeting of the Society for Industrial Microbiology and Biotechnology in San Francisco from August 7-10 at the Hyatt Regency. DOTS combines a network of sensors and actuators with powerful software to monitor Critical Process Parameters (CPPs) on a continuous basis.

    In bioprocessing, researchers and engineers are interested in a broad variety of parameters (e.g. pH or biomass) for various vessel types (e.g. shake flasks, bags and custom bioreactor systems). For many of the needed parameters, applications and vessel types, no suitable sensors are available. If they are available, researchers often need to source them from different suppliers, ending up with application- and vessel-specific sensors and software products. This creates a complex landscape of sensors, suppliers, software products, user interfaces, calibration logics and other factors.

    To support the existing variety of applications from microbial fermentation to cell and gene therapy, a broad portfolio of sensors will be available on the DOTS platform, starting with sensors for biomass, pH and DO for various vessel types. These sensors are then combined with the innovative DOTS Software. The DOTS Software provides a modern and intuitive user interface, contains pre-defined application templates to allow experiment set-up with the least clicks possible and provides innovative features like biomass-based feeding in shake flasks. The DOTS Software is not a cloud solution, so users keep full control over their data and can locally deploy it.
